Originally Posted by Russ1974' post='511845' date='Dec 30 2007, 01:28 PM
Really? I wouldn't have ranked them in that order. Can you post a link to your source of this info?
2 sources.

Pretty much any car magazine will tell you that Audi's lose a greater proportion of their values than MB or BMW. They will also claim that BMW's and MB's retain similar values, but this isn't true (see 2nd point below)

Secondly, every time I change my car (around every 2 years), I extensively research the used car market when deciding whether to 'opt out' of the company car scheme. Audi's back up the car mags stats having lost most value from new (being slightly less prestigious than the other 2 marques) but MB's that started life as the same price as a BMW can be 5-10% more costly used. This isn't always apparent at main dealers but if you study the wider market then this is fairly consistent.

Even though I'm a BMW convert and have only run 1 Mercedes that I didn't get on with, I'd have to concede that MB is the slightly more prestigious brand, which probably explains the better retained values.
